Our Gate Motor & Opener Services in Ecorse

Motor Repair

Most Ecorse gate motor failures trace back to two things: corrosion eating the limit switches and circuit board, or a post that has shifted and is binding the whole mechanism. We open the enclosure, check for the kind of iron-oxide dust that settles out of the air near Zug Island, clean the contacts, test the board, and only recommend replacement when the board is actually dead. Hal’s repair-first approach means the gate stays in your driveway and gets welded or rewired on site. You don’t pay for parts you don’t need.

Slide Motor

Slide gates make sense on Ecorse’s dense, compact lots. A swing gate needs room to arc, and most of these 1920s and 1930s bungalows do not have it. But a slide operator on a shared driveway has to be compact, and the rack and pinion has to stay aligned. Frost heave in the clay-heavy soil tilts the post a quarter inch, the gear track shifts, and the motor stalls. We realign the post, reset the track, and replace the rack with stainless steel when the old one has rusted thin along West Jefferson.

Linear Motor

Linear openers are common on the short, narrow gates that fit Ecorse’s small front yards. The problem we see most often is the threaded shaft corroding where the fine industrial dust builds up in the grease, turning it into grinding paste. We clean the shaft, regrease with a corrosion-resistant compound, and replace the shaft when it’s pitted. A linear motor that gets that service once a year will outlast one that gets ignored until the gate stops halfway and sits there blocking the driveway.

Battery Backup

Power blinks on the grid that feeds Ecorse from the riverfront substations, and a gate without backup becomes a locked gate. We install battery backup systems rated for the specific operator, and we use sealed enclosures because of the airborne fallout that would otherwise coat the terminals and drain the battery in a season. You’ll still get in and out when the power is down, and that is the whole point of having a gate motor in the first place.

Common Gate Motor & Opener Problems We See in Ecorse Homes

  • Circuit board failure from iron-oxide dust. The fine particles that settle out of the air from Zug Island’s blast furnaces are conductive. They coat the board, bridge connections, and cause intermittent failures that drive homeowners nuts because the gate works fine until it doesn’t. A sealed enclosure or a regular cleaning fixes most of these.
  • Post heave after wet falls and hard winters. The Detroit River keeps humidity high year-round, and when a wet fall is followed by a deep freeze, the clay soil under the gate posts expands and contracts violently. The post tilts, the rack misaligns, and the slide motor strains until it overheats or trips its thermal protection. Post realignment is almost always the first step.
  • Rusted rack and pinion on slide gates. Along West Jefferson Avenue and a few blocks inland, a painted steel rack can rust through within two or three seasons. The teeth lose their profile, the gate jerks and grinds, and eventually the motor stalls under load. We replace with stainless rack and pinion hardware.
  • Shared driveway operators without safety edges. Many Ecorse driveways are shared, with rights of way that predate the current gates. Older installations often lack photocells or safety edges, which is dangerous and also hard on the motor. We add those safety devices on every installation, no exceptions.

Pricing for Gate Motor & Opener in Ecorse, MI

Here’s what you’re looking at in this market. A circuit board replacement on a common FAAC or Linear operator in Ecorse runs $220-$380, including the part and the labor to install and test it. A full slide motor replacement, installed with a stainless rack and new safety photocells, typically runs $850-$1,400 depending on gate length and whether we need to recore or realign a post. Battery backup installation runs $350-$550, and the price is quoted and agreed before any work starts.
